Ezekiel 41:2 / KJV
2. And the breadth of the door was ten cubits; and the sides of the door were five cubits on the one side, and five cubits on the other side: and he measured the length thereof, forty cubits: and the breadth, twenty cubits.

Strong Code definitions

H7341 rochab ro'-khab from H7337; width (literally or figuratively):--breadth, broad, largeness, thickness, wideness.see H7337

H6607 pethach peh'-thakh from H6605; an opening (literally), i.e. door (gate) or entrance way:--door, entering (in), entrance (-ry), gate, opening, place.see H6605

H6235 `eser eh'ser masculine of term aasarah {as-aw-raw'}; from H6237; ten (as an accumulation to the extent of the digits):--ten, (fif-,seven-)teen. see H6237

H520 'ammah am-maw' prolonged from H517; properly, a mother (i.e. unit of measure, or the fore-arm (below the elbow), i.e. a cubit; also adoor-base (as a bond of the entrance):--cubit, + hundred (by exchange for H3967), measure, post. see H517 see H3967

H3802 katheph kaw-thafe' from an unused root meaning to clothe; the shoulder (proper,i.e. upper end of the arm; as being the spot where the garments hang); figuratively, side-piece or lateral projection of anything:--arm, corner, shoulder(-piece), side, undersetter.
